Radif Mustafa
Radif Mustafa is a 56-year-old former human rights lawyer and the head of the Accountability Department in the Syrian Commission for Transitional Justice. After being imprisoned and tortured by the Assad regime, he escaped to Turkey and returned following Assad's downfall. Mustafa advocates for the establishment of a new legal framework to address human rights violations committed since the Assad family's rise to power, emphasizing the necessity of justice for Syria's future stability.
